The travel time between West Hampstead Thameslink and Nottingham by train varies depending on the type of train and the route, but the average journey time is 2hrs 30 mins & the fastest journey takes 1hrs 58 mins.
The fastest journey time by train from West Hampstead Thameslink to Nottingham is 1hrs 58 mins.
Train ticket prices from West Hampstead Thameslink to Nottingham can start from as little as £17.40 when you book in advance. The cost of tickets can vary depending on the time of day, route and class you book and are usually more expensive if you book on the day.
The departure and arrival times for trains between West Hampstead Thameslink and Nottingham vary depending on the day of the week and the type of train. Generally, there are around 37 departures and arrivals throughout the day. The first departure is 05:01, and the last train of the day leaves at 00:57.

No, unfortunately there are no direct trains between West Hampstead Thameslink & Nottingham. However, there are 37 possible journeys which require a change.
Thameslink and East Midlands Railway are the main train operating companies running services between West Hampstead Thameslink and Nottingham.

The ticket facilities at West Hampstead Thameslink are designed to cater to every traveler’s need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to late evening, providing convenience for those early commutes or late-night returns. For tech-savvy travelers, ticket machines are readily available, offering the capability to collect tickets purchased online. Moreover, advanced systems like smartcard issuance and validation are in practice, ensuring a swift transition from station to train.
The station boasts step-free access throughout, making it accessible for everyone, including those with mobility issues. Assistance can be pre-booked or availed on arrival, ensuring that every passenger experiences a smooth journey. Though the station lacks accessible toilets and waiting rooms, its commitment to accessibility is evident, with induction loops, ramps for train access, and seating areas abundantly available.
Ensuring optimal convenience, West Hampstead Thameslink is well-integrated with diverse transport links. With accessible entry and exit points and customer help points, getting to and from the station is smooth. While there is no provision for cycle hire, the station offers 42 bicycle storage spaces fitted with CCTV for added security.

This buzzing station is more than just a gateway to your next destination. It's equipped with all the facilities you need for a comfortable and convenient journey. Nottingham Station hosts a well-staffed ticket office open from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 7:15 AM to 8:00 PM on Sundays. Travelers can also utilize ticket machines for a quicker, self-service option, including accessible machines for those who need them. The station supports smartcards and offers easy ticket collection services for online purchases.
For those who require assistance, Nottingham Station ensures easy and inclusive access with features like step-free access throughout, available lifts to all platforms, and numerous ramps. Help points and an information desk are ready to assist, making it easier for everyone to travel with confidence. The presence of CCTVs adds an extra layer of security to your trip.
When it comes to creature comforts, you'll find heated waiting rooms, accessible restrooms, including a baby changing facility, and a variety of cafes and vending machines for a quick snack or refreshment. There’s also a chance to indulge in a bit of retail therapy at the on-site shops. Unfortunately, Wi-Fi is not yet available, so be sure to download all your important details before you arrive.
Getting to and from Nottingham Station is made simple with a range of transport options. Rail replacement buses conveniently operate from Carrington Street directly in front of the station, ensuring you're never stranded if regular services are suspended. For those looking to explore the city, local bus services connect the station to various parts of Nottingham, managed by a comprehensive network.
Nottingham is also part of the vibrant tram network known as the Nottingham Express Transit. Not to mention, there's through-ticketing available for seamless travel to East Midlands Airport, courtesy of the regular Skylink service operated by Nottingham City Transport. This makes your journey from the train station to the skies as smooth as possible.
